scope:
This part of this European Standard applies to lifting plants for wastewater containing faecal matter for limited applications used for draining a single WC according to EN 33 or EN 37 to which it is directly connected and located below flood level. Plants for limited applications are those where the number of users is small, where there is an other WC available above flood level, and the plants serve no more than one wash-hand basin, one shower and one bidet provided they pass the test described in clause 8 and they are installed in accordance with EN 12056-1 and no other sanitary appliance is directly or indictly connected. In addition, limited application means that the plant is located in the same room as the WC and any other appliance served by it. This part of this standard contains general requirements, basic construction and testing principles, together with information on materials and conformity evaluation. Construction and testing requirements for non-return valves used in faecal lifting plants for limited applications are given in EN 12050-4:2000.
